Passing through the emotionally-charged, traditional Kyoto townhouse alleys, one will find the quietly standing long-standing Japanese restaurant "Tsuroku." Walking through the narrow alleys lined with traditional townhouses of Kyoto feels like entering another world. The dignified facade and the warmth of the wooden interior invite visitors into the world of Japanese aesthetics.
Instead of the traditional kaiseki multi-course meals, "Tsuroku" offers a style of dining that allows patrons to enjoy a variety of a la carte dishes. This style of dining allows customers to savor the flavors of the ingredients and the uniqueness of each dish at their leisure. In particular, the specialty sweetfish rice is a masterpiece of exquisite seasoning and harmonious fragrance.
